Day 33

Matthew 2:13-15 

Jesus’ first childhood memories would be of living in Egypt—as a political refugee/immigrant.  While his family may have had a place to live, it was not “home” and it was not secure.  Immigrants and refugees have few rights and limited access to safe, stable, sanitary housing.  They are often victims of unscrupulous landlords and cannot defend themselves easily because of language, culture barriers and fear of exposure if they are undocumented.   What do you think God wants us to learn from Jesus’ experience as a displaced person?
